INDIANAPOLIS - Some local names made the list for the 2024 Indiana Academic All-State Team.
To qualify you must be a senior, as well as play in 70% of the team games. If a player is the valedictorian or salutatorian of their school, it is an automatic qualification. Students can also qualify with a score of 8 on the academic formula. That is a combination of a student’s GPA and SAT/ACT scores.
Adam Kunkel from South Dearborn, Eli Loichinger from Batesville High School, and Carter Bohman from Batesville High School were among the names of almost 200 student athletes.
